这个错误在哪呢 就让我输入自增ID

来源:7-5 PHP数据库操作之插入新数据到MySQL中

宝慕林9486550

2019-08-13 10:02

<?php

//连接数据库

mysql_connect('127.0.0.1', 'code1', '');

mysql_select_db('code1');

mysql_query("set names 'utf8'");

//已知的数据变量有

$name = '李四';

$age = 18;

$class = '高三一班';

//在这里进行数据查询

$sql="insert into user(name,age,class)values('$name','$age','$class')";

mysql_query($sql);

$uid=mysql_insert_id();

echo $uid;


写回答 关注

4回答

  • 木有饭
    2019-09-26 16:25:19

    这是因为模拟的数据库操作都是错误的,根本没有插入数据,所以没有自增逐渐返回。不过,我们自己可以欺骗下校验程序:

    http://img2.mukewang.com/5d8c75ea000193c905590359.jpg

  • 宝慕林9486550
    2019-08-13 13:47:26

    知道的大佬帮忙看看  感激不尽

  • 宝慕林9486550
    2019-08-13 10:14:15

    打错了   var_dump($uid);

  • 宝慕林9486550
    2019-08-13 10:12:00

    要是把结尾换成  $var_dump($uid);   就会这样

    https://img2.mukewang.com/5d521c6e0001557c08210628.jpg

PHP进阶篇

轻松学习PHP中级课程,进行全面了解,用PHP快速开发网站程序

181727 学习 · 2575 问题

查看课程

相似问题